This conversation with Professor Emerita Debbie Epstein explores her political activism in
South Africa and academic works in the United Kingdom (UK). In particular, the interview
focuses on her political involvement against the Apartheid system, which caused her to leave
the country six months after starting her undergraduate study at the University of the
Witwatersrand. Moreover, the interview discusses Epstein’s transition to the UK and her work
on gender and education, elite schools, anti-racist education and Southern theories. This
interview contributes to understanding factors that affect access and equity in education.
